Top 5 Investing and Financial Management Apps on Android in Estonia, Q1 2022
In Q1 2022, the top investing and financial management apps on the Android platform in Estonia saw varied performance in weekly downloads and revenue. Detailed insights from Sensor Tower reveal the trends.
In Q1 2022, several leading investing and financial management apps on the Android platform in Estonia demonstrated varied performance in terms of downloads and activity. Here’s a closer look at the top 5 apps, as per the latest data from Sensor Tower.
Change: Buy Bitcoin & crypto from Change Finance saw a relatively stable trend in weekly downloads. Starting with around 437 downloads in the last week of December, the app experienced a peak of 556 downloads in the week of February 7. The quarter concluded with the app maintaining a download rate close to its earlier peak, reaching 545 downloads in the final week of March.
Admirals・Stocks trading from Admiral Markets had a notable spike in downloads early in the quarter, with a high of 859 downloads by the end of January. However, this was followed by a sharp decline, tapering off to just 24 downloads in the last week of March.
Binance: Buy Bitcoin & Crypto from Binance Inc. showed a more fluctuating pattern. Starting the quarter with 251 downloads in late December, the app saw a dip in February but managed to climb back up to 283 downloads by the end of March.
Crypto.com - Buy Bitcoin, ETH from Crypto Technology Holdings Limited experienced a consistent download rate throughout the quarter. Beginning with 297 downloads in late December, the numbers remained relatively steady, finishing the quarter at 203 downloads in the last week of March.
MetaMask - Blockchain Wallet from MetaMask Web3 Wallet had a mixed performance in weekly downloads. Starting with 205 downloads in the last week of December, the app saw a decline mid-quarter, reaching a low of 74 downloads at the end of February. However, it recovered slightly to 121 downloads by the end of March.
